所需软件:
vscode,官网链接下载:https://code.visualstudio.com/;(也可以用自己习惯的编辑器)
node.js,官网链接下载:http://nodejs.cn/
安装自己电脑的合适版本即可。
安装这些一般直接点击下一步即可,对于一些国外的软件注意安装目录中最好不要有中文路径,以免出现问题。
1.首先我们进入终端创建一个expresstest目录,进入重点安装脚手架命令:npm install express-generator -g
“-g”为全局安装,mac安装如果出现错误请在前面加上sudo npm install express-generator -g 输入电脑密码提升权限安装。
2.安装完后我们终端cd进入expresstest目录,用express-generator脚手架来新建一个express项目输入:express test1
创建完后会出现提醒,我们按照提示进入:
1.进入项目:
cd test1
2.安装项目依赖:
npm install
3.运行开启项目:
npm start
3.我们把整个项目目录拖动到vscode即可编辑。
4.我们可以再进行安装另一个比较好用的插件,nodemon 是一款每当文件修改后都自动重启项目的插件。
终端输入进行安装:npm i nodemon cross-env --save-dev
5.然后进行编辑器找到package.json在scripts对象中添加"dev": “cross-env NODE_ENV=dev nodemon ./bin/www,js”
package.json全部代码:
{
"name": "test1",
"version": "0.0.0",
"private": true,
"scripts": {
"start": "node ./bin/www",
"dev": "cross-env NODE_ENV=dev nodemon ./bin/www,js"
},
"dependencies": {
"cookie-parser": "~1.4.4",
"debug": "~2.6.9",
"express": "~4.16.1",
"http-errors": "~1.6.3",
"jade": "~1.11.0",
"morgan": "~1.9.1"
},
"devDependencies": {
"cross-env": "^7.0.3",
"nodemon": "^2.0.7"
}
}
(以后我们在终端通过npm run dev 来启动项目即可实现保存项目自动重启)
本文章是我一个字一个字的打出来,图也是我自己做,也是按照我一个初学者的理解思维去写的,本人也是正在看各种视频学习进步中,发现一些好的会写出来也算给自己加深印象吧,顺便记录一下代码,如果有说的不对的地方还望指出,万分感激!
谢谢